Frontier Developments plc

 EBT Share Purchase

Frontier Developments plc (AIM: FDEV, "Frontier", the "Company") was notified on 12 May 2023, by Ocorian Limited, the trustee of the Frontier Developments plc Employee Benefit Trust (the "EBT"), that the EBT had purchased 68,623 ordinary shares of 0.5p each in the Company ("Ordinary Shares") at an average price of 533 pence per Ordinary Share on 12 May 2023. These Ordinary Shares are to be held in the EBT and are intended to be used to satisfy the exercise of share options by employees. The EBT is a discretionary trust for the benefit of the Company's employees, including the Directors of the Company. The purchase of Ordinary Shares by the EBT has been funded from the Company's existing cash resources.

Following this transaction, a total of 473,714 Ordinary Shares are held by the EBT, representing approximately 1.20 per cent of the Company's total voting rights.

 About Frontier Developments plc

Frontier is a leading independent developer and publisher of videogames founded in 1994 by David Braben, co-author of the iconic Elite game. Based in Cambridge, Frontier uses its proprietary COBRA game development technology to create innovative genre-leading games, primarily for personal computers and videogame consoles. As well as self-publishing internally developed games, Frontier also publishes games developed by carefully selected partner studios under its Frontier Foundry games label.
